The outcome of extubation failure in a community hospital intensive care unit: a cohort study.

A higher proportion of patients who failed extubation expired in the ICU (OR = 12.2, 95% confidence interval = 1.5–101; P < 0.05), although hospital mortality of reintubated patients did not reach statistical significance (OR = 2.1, 95% confidence interval = 0.8–5.4; P > 0.05).
